Justice Catalyst Fellowship
Organization: Justice Catalyst Partnerships (VA, US)
Status: Active. Application form is generally open in the Fall of each year. Check back in Summer 2026 for the 2026-2027 application cycle.
Program Type: One-year, potentially renewable, project-based fellowships
Geographic Scope: United States

How to Apply
Application Process
1. Timeline: Application form is generally open in the Fall of each year
2. When to Apply: Check back in Summer 2026 for the 2026-2027 cycle opening
3. Where to Apply: Complete application form on the Justice Catalyst Fellowship Application page
4. Required Materials: Application form with responses to cycle questions (view 2026-2027 questions on application page)
5. Letters of Recommendation: NOT accepted at the application stage
6. Post-Application: If you accept another fellowship or position elsewhere during the process, notify fellowships@justicecatalyst.org immediately
